The most affordable mobility scooters offer a wide range of features to suit various needs. Decide how you will make use of it, and consult your insurance company to determine if they cover some of the cost.

Also consider the weight of the heaviest piece, incline rating, top speed, and turning radius. Some models come with storage baskets and safety features like lights.

2. Drive Medical Roadsters S4

The Roadsters S4 is a great travel scooter for those who don't wish to break the bank. The four-wheeled scooter is broken down into five pieces that are easy to transport. The largest one weighs 36 pounds and is easy to move in your vehicle. This scooter also comes with a full lighting package and 33 AH batteries that can be used all day long.

The mobility scooter also comes with independent front and rear suspensions. This ensures an easy and stable ride particularly on uneven terrain. The model is also disassembled, which means you do not require tools to disassemble it. The Roadsters S4 comes in blue or red, and comes with a large, comfortable adjustable seat.

The mobility scooter comes with a variety of features that you will love including its light construction, large basket in the front, and a large seat. It comes with a handy USB charger and a full lighting package that is standard. It even has an maximum weight capacity of 350 pounds.

The majority of scooters can travel at speeds that exceed eight miles per hour, which is sufficient to travel around the block and even to the local grocery store. If you are planning to go on longer trips, look for a scooter with a higher top speed.

The majority of manufacturers offer a limited warranty for life on the motors, frame, and drivetrain of their mobility scooters. Many also offer a one-year in-home service plan that comes with the purchase of a new scooter. This is a great method to ensure that your mobility scooter will run smoothly and safely for many years to come.

4. Glashow Mobility Scooter - S3

The Glashow Mobility Scooter S3 has an impressive range of up to 25 miles on one charge. Its high-powered motor and big wheels (9" front and 10" rear) enable it to effortlessly navigate through a variety of road surfaces and smoothly cross curbs that are up to 2.76 inches tall. The scooter also comes with an easy two-step folding mechanism that allows it to be easily stored in your trunk or car boot.
